Homborsund is a quintessential Southern Norwegian coastal village that has an excellent blend of maritime history and remarkable natural landscapes. Positioned along the Skagerrak strait, this scenic destination is characterized by its traditional white wooden houses, sheltered coves, and an animated archipelago that comes alive during the summer. The village provides an idyllic retreat for those who appreciate the tranquility of the sea and the refreshing coastal breezes of the Nordic summer. A major highlight for visitors is the local swimming culture, perfectly embodied by the Homborsund badebrygge. This inviting swimming pier and beach area allows tourists to dive into the refreshing, clear waters. Surrounded by smooth granite skerries and lush coastal vegetation, it is an excellent spot for sunbathing, picnicking, and enjoying the bright summer days. The calm waters in the sheltered bays make it particularly family-friendly and safe for swimming. Beyond the beaches, Homborsund provides the iconic Homborsund Lighthouse, situated on an island just off the coast, which is a popular destination for boat trips and kayaking. The local culinary scene revolves around fresh seafood, with shrimp often enjoyed directly on the docks. Easily accessible by car from nearby Grimstad, Homborsund perfectly captures the slow-paced, nautical charm of the Norwegian Riviera.

Best time to visit & climate
The most pleasant time to visit is Jun–Aug.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°C | 0 | 0 | 2 | 6 | 10 | 14 | 16 | 16 | 13 | 8 | 5 | 2 |
| Rain mm | 119 | 86 | 77 | 67 | 85 | 86 | 96 | 118 | 112 | 146 | 133 | 118 |
